<html xmlns:v="urn:schemas-microsoft-com:vml" xmlns:o="urn:schemas-microsoft-com:office:office" xmlns:w="urn:schemas-microsoft-com:office:word" xmlns:m="http://schemas.microsoft.com/office/2004/12/omml" xmlns="http://www.w3.org/TR/REC-html40"><head><meta http-equiv=Content-Type content="text/html; charset=utf-8"><meta name=Generator content="Microsoft Word 14 (filtered medium)"><!--[if !mso]><style>v\:* {behavior:url(#default#VML);}
o\:* {behavior:url(#default#VML);}
w\:* {behavior:url(#default#VML);}
.shape {behavior:url(#default#VML);}
</style><![endif]--><style><!--
/* Font Definitions */
@font-face
        {font-family:SimSun;
        panose-1:2 1 6 0 3 1 1 1 1 1;}
@font-face
        {font-family:"MS Gothic";
        panose-1:2 11 6 9 7 2 5 8 2 4;}
@font-face
        {font-family:"MS Gothic";
        panose-1:2 11 6 9 7 2 5 8 2 4;}
@font-face
        {font-family:Calibri;
        panose-1:2 15 5 2 2 2 4 3 2 4;}
@font-face
        {font-family:Tahoma;
        panose-1:2 11 6 4 3 5 4 4 2 4;}
@font-face
        {font-family:Consolas;
        panose-1:2 11 6 9 2 2 4 3 2 4;}
@font-face
        {font-family:"\@MS Gothic";
        panose-1:2 11 6 9 7 2 5 8 2 4;}
@font-face
        {font-family:"\@SimSun";
        panose-1:2 1 6 0 3 1 1 1 1 1;}
/* Style Definitions */
p.MsoNormal, li.MsoNormal, div.MsoNormal
        {margin:0in;
        margin-bottom:.0001pt;
        font-size:12.0pt;
        font-family:"Times New Roman","serif";
        color:black;}
a:link, span.MsoHyperlink
        {mso-style-priority:99;
        color:blue;
        text-decoration:underline;}
a:visited, span.MsoHyperlinkFollowed
        {mso-style-priority:99;
        color:purple;
        text-decoration:underline;}
p
        {mso-style-priority:99;
        mso-margin-top-alt:auto;
        margin-right:0in;
        mso-margin-bottom-alt:auto;
        margin-left:0in;
        font-size:12.0pt;
        font-family:"Times New Roman","serif";
        color:black;}
pre
        {mso-style-priority:99;
        mso-style-link:"HTML Preformatted Char";
        margin:0in;
        margin-bottom:.0001pt;
        font-size:10.0pt;
        font-family:"Courier New";
        color:black;}
span.HTMLPreformattedChar
        {mso-style-name:"HTML Preformatted Char";
        mso-style-priority:99;
        mso-style-link:"HTML Preformatted";
        font-family:"Consolas","serif";
        color:black;}
span.EmailStyle20
        {mso-style-type:personal-reply;
        font-family:"Calibri","sans-serif";
        color:#1F497D;}
.MsoChpDefault
        {mso-style-type:export-only;
        font-size:10.0pt;}
@page WordSection1
        {size:8.5in 11.0in;
        margin:1.0in 1.0in 1.0in 1.0in;}
div.WordSection1
        {page:WordSection1;}
--></style><!--[if gte mso 9]><xml>
<o:shapedefaults v:ext="edit" spidmax="1026" />
</xml><![endif]--><!--[if gte mso 9]><xml>
<o:shapelayout v:ext="edit">
<o:idmap v:ext="edit" data="1" />
</o:shapelayout></xml><![endif]--></head><body bgcolor=white lang=EN-US link=blue vlink=purple><div class=WordSection1><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'>Looks good Jim. I would suggest also submitting a session version of the tutorial and focusing on the basics of IDNA and email standards. That talk will be complementary to the framework talk in explaining what they need to support and would be a good lead in. The tutorial is a good idea but it might be too broad in scope.<o:p></o:p></span></p><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'><o:p>&nbsp;</o:p></span></p><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'>I have presented on IDNA before at the conference and would be glad to give you my slides as a basis for you to work with, or work jointly with you on a session talk on it. I cant offer to do a joint tutorial talk as I have submitted my usual tutorial talks already.<o:p></o:p></span></p><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'><o:p>&nbsp;</o:p></span></p><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'>I think you have time to slip another session in  if you are quick.<o:p></o:p></span></p><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'><o:p>&nbsp;</o:p></span></p><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'>Ping me directly if you want to chat about this.<o:p></o:p></span></p><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'>tex<o:p></o:p></span></p><p class=MsoNormal><span style='font-size:11.0pt;font-family:"Calibri","sans-serif";color:#1F497D'><o:p>&nbsp;</o:p></span></p><div><div style='border:none;border-top:solid #B5C4DF 1.0pt;padding:3.0pt 0in 0in 0in'><p class=MsoNormal><b><span style='font-size:10.0pt;font-family:"Tahoma","sans-serif";color:windowtext'>From:</span></b><span style='font-size:10.0pt;font-family:"Tahoma","sans-serif";color:windowtext'> ua-discuss-bounces@icann.org [mailto:ua-discuss-bounces@icann.org] <b>On Behalf Of </b>Jim DeLaHunt<br><b>Sent:</b> Friday, March 24, 2017 1:13 AM<br><b>To:</b> ua-discuss@icann.org<br><b>Subject:</b> [UA-discuss] FYI, an IUC41 presentation proposal on UA<o:p></o:p></span></p></div></div><p class=MsoNormal><o:p>&nbsp;</o:p></p><p>Hello, UA colleagues:<o:p></o:p></p><p>Two weeks ago we had a thread about my interest in seeing Universal Acceptance proposals submitted to the 41st Internationalization and Unicode Conference (IUC41).&nbsp; Based on that discussion, I am working on a proposal for a 50-minute presentation. I'd like to run these by you for your information. I appreciate any feedback you have.<o:p></o:p></p><div class=MsoNormal align=center style='text-align:center'><hr size=2 width="100%" align=center></div><p><b>Presentation title</b>: Universal Acceptance of non-Latin email addresses and domain names: how does your framework rate?<o:p></o:p></p><p><b>Abstract</b>:<o:p></o:p></p><p>The next one billion internet users use a wide variety of languages and scripts. They will demand email addresses, and domain names, in scripts they can easily read. App development frameworks, libraries, and programming languages on all platforms will be called on to meet this challenge. This is Universal Acceptance (UA) — of all domain names and email addresses, from <a href="http://普遍接受-测试。世界">http://<span style='font-family:"MS Gothic"'>普遍接受</span>-<span style='font-family:SimSun'>测试。世界</span></a> [simplifed Chinese] to مانيش @ أشوكا. الهند [arabic] to <a href="mailto:données@fußballplatz.technology">données@fußballplatz.technology</a> [latin non-ASCII]. We present technical compliance criteria, a list of problem areas, and ways to evaluate compliance. We give our compliance findings so far. Does your library and platform provide Universal Acceptance? <br><br>Universal Acceptance is a foundational requirement for a truly multilingual Internet, one in which users around the world can navigate entirely in local languages. It is also the key to unlocking the potential of new generic top-level domains (gTLDs) to foster competition, consumer choice and innovation in the domain name industry. To achieve Universal Acceptance, Internet applications and systems must treat all TLDs in a consistent manner, including new gTLDs and internationalized TLDs. Specifically, they must accept, validate, store, process and display all domain names and email addresses.<br><br>This talk presents a compliance review plan, for the programming languages and frameworks with which applications are built. It has a list of UA features to check, and gives reference correct results. Application developers can use these tests to be sure the tools they use afford Universal Acceptance. Framework developers can use these tests to be sure that they provide access to the right scope of Universal Acceptance functionality, and that it works well.&nbsp; There is a complementary compliance review plan of application features, which we will also look at.<br><br>This compliance review plan are the work of the Universal Acceptance Steering Group (<a href="https://uasg.tech/">https://uasg.tech/</a>). An ICANN project, the UASG is a community-based team working to share this vision for the Internet of the future with those who construct this space: coders. The group’s primary objective is to help software developers and website owners understand how to update their systems to keep pace with an evolving domain name system (DNS).<br><br>The UASG has done its own compliance evaluation for selected frameworks and programming languages. We will go over these results. <br><br>This talk is complementary with Dr Ajay Data's presentation on Data Xgen's experience developing email services with non-Latin email addresses and domain names. <br><br>This talk is suitable for product owners, application developers, programming language and framework developers, testers, domain registars, email hosting companies, management, and developers. Plus, anyone who looks forward to using email addresses and domain names in non-Latin scripts will find this evaluation of interest.<o:p></o:p></p><p>[Note: I plan to base this mainly on the contents of &quot;Reviewing programming languages and frameworks for compliance with Universal Acceptance good practice&quot;]<o:p></o:p></p><p><b>Ram and other leaders</b>: Is it all right for me to identify myself as a member of UASG, and this talk as being a UASG presentation, and use the UASG templates?&nbsp; I don't mind just proposing an individual talk, but I think having the UASG branding would be stronger.<o:p></o:p></p><div class=MsoNormal align=center style='text-align:center'><hr size=2 width="100%" align=center></div><p>I am also working on a proposal for a 1.5 hour tutorial. <o:p></o:p></p><p><b>Tutorial Title</b>: Domain names and email addresses aren't just ASCII anymore.&nbsp; Now what?<o:p></o:p></p><p><b>Tutorial Concept</b>: Explain IDN and EAI, and their implications, for an audience that doesn't know either. The next billion internet users. Explain Punycode and how it's the ASCII labels that are registered. Show the thousands of gTLDs, and how to get the current list. Talk about policy issues like joint registration. Talk about confusables, as a security issue and a trademark issue. Introduce UASG and other groups working on these issues. Review the portfolio of UASG materials and how participants can apply them, both to the software they developed, and to that they procure.<o:p></o:p></p><p>I think the tutorial extends beyond UASG, so I'm leaning towards presenting it as an individual tutorial.<o:p></o:p></p><p>N.B. It's my practice to freely licence my presentation materials with CC-BY, so they will be available for others to re-use. <o:p></o:p></p><p>Also, as alluded to above, I understand that Dr Ajay Data has proposed a presentation on Data Xgen's experience developing email services with non-Latin email addresses and domain names. I think this will be interesting by itself, and even better in combination with the UASG material in my proposal.<o:p></o:p></p><p>Who knows whether the program committee will accept any of these proposals?&nbsp; They will give us their answer towards the end of April.<o:p></o:p></p><p>One final reminder: if anyone else wants to propose a talk, 24. March is the deadline! Details at &lt;<a href="http://www.unicodeconference.org/call-for-participation.htm">http://www.unicodeconference.org/call-for-participation.htm</a>&gt;.<o:p></o:p></p><p class=MsoNormal>Once again, your feedback is welcome. Best regards,<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; --Jim DeLaHunt<br><br><br><o:p></o:p></p><pre>-- <o:p></o:p></pre><pre>    --Jim DeLaHunt, <a href="mailto:jdlh@jdlh.com">jdlh@jdlh.com</a>     <a href="http://blog.jdlh.com/">http://blog.jdlh.com/</a> (<a href="http://jdlh.com/">http://jdlh.com/</a>)<o:p></o:p></pre><pre>      multilingual websites consultant<o:p></o:p></pre><pre><o:p>&nbsp;</o:p></pre><pre>      355-1027 Davie St, Vancouver BC V6E 4L2, Canada<o:p></o:p></pre><pre>         Canada mobile +1-604-376-8953<o:p></o:p></pre></div></body></html>